Hi Petra — handing over the Q3 stock-count ledger before I head off. It's fully reconciled, just the cover sheet left to sign. Keep it in the locked drawer until Wednesday, when the courier from Halvert Runners picks it up for the Brinmoor archive. Nothing unusual this quarter, happily. For the hand-over itself, follow the confidential line below:

handover note for yagef-bagep: the drudor pelius courier leaves the kasdor zorvan norir ledger at gate 8016 under passcode 755406

Welcome to the team. Please note that responsibility for the PickPath warehouse optimizer has recently changed hands. This service computes pick-list routes for all three fulfillment sites, and its bin-weighting model is retrained weekly, so treat any config change as production-critical. Review the onboarding doc before proposing changes, and route all questions about routing logic, retraining schedules, or incident escalation to the new owner. Effective immediately, the responsible engineer is named below.

named custodian: Brivan Eliath Quenox Frador

Handover: Splitgate assignment service. Bucketing is deterministic off the visitor hash; don't touch the salt or every experiment reshuffles. Known issue: stale assignments linger in the edge cache ~10 min after an experiment ends. Cleanup job runs hourly. Deploys go through the Corvel pipeline; canary first, always. Config lives in the sealed store. If you need to rotate the salt or restore assignment history after an outage, the sealed store unlocks with the recovery passphrase below.

vault phrase of bafop-kahop = sormir-frador